Proper Eating for Your Labrador 

With a nutritious diet, your dog will develop and improve the strength and health of their teeth. Making sure you have the proper dog food to help get rid of plaque, get the right amount of enzymes, and controlling tartar will ultimately make your dog happier and healthier.

Chew Toys Improve Dental Strength 

Chew toys help keep your dog occupied and busy, but they also have dental advantages as well. Chew treats and toys help to remove plaque and tartar from your Labrador’s teeth. Also, they make specific non-edible chew toys like rubber bones that are meant for teeth cleaning with your Labrador. Whenever you have the chance, keep picking up some new chew toys for your Labrador. This is a great way to help your dog clean their own teeth. 

Brushing Your Dog’s Teeth 

Brushing your Labrador’s teeth on the regular will greatly improve their health. Make a schedule for yourself, so that you can have a consistent task of brushing their teeth. Starting them young is very important, so they can get accumulated with a consistent routine. Buy a toothbrush and toothpaste specific to your Labrador. The trick to brushing your Lab’s teeth is to approach them in a calm way and make sure that you’re brushing gently.
